If you’ve ever wished for a sauce that’s rich, velvety, and packed with savory mushroom goodness, you’re in for a treat with Creamy Mushroom Gravy: The Ultimate Comfort Topping Recipe. This luscious gravy brings a warm, earthy flavor that instantly transforms everyday dishes like mashed potatoes, roasted vegetables, or grilled meats into something truly special. It’s the kind of recipe that feels decadent yet surprisingly simple to make, inviting you to cozy up with comfort food that tastes homemade and heartwarming.

Ingredients You’ll Need
The magic of this recipe lies in its straightforward ingredients that are easy to find yet combine to create something rich and flavorful. Each element plays a crucial role in building the creamy texture, deep umami, and perfect balance of the gravy.
- Butter (2 tablespoons): Adds richness and helps sauté the mushrooms to golden perfection.
- Olive oil (1 tablespoon): Balances the butter and prevents burning while bringing subtle fruitiness.
- Mushrooms (8 oz, sliced): Cremini or button mushrooms bring hearty, earthy flavor and body to the gravy.
- Small onion (finely chopped): Provides sweetness and depth to the gravy base.
- Garlic (2 cloves, minced): Infuses a gentle pungency that enhances the overall taste.
- All-purpose flour (2 tablespoons): Thickens the gravy to a smooth, luscious consistency.
- Vegetable or chicken broth (1 1/2 cups): The liquid foundation that carries the flavors and keeps it saucy yet substantial.
- Heavy cream (1/2 cup): Creates the signature creamy texture; milk can be substituted for a lighter option.
- Soy sauce (1 teaspoon, optional): Adds an unexpected umami punch to deepen the flavor profile.
- Salt and pepper (to taste): Essential to balance and enhance every ingredient in the gravy.
- Fresh thyme or parsley (1 tablespoon, chopped, optional): Offers bright herbal notes for garnish or stirred in at the end.
How to Make Creamy Mushroom Gravy: The Ultimate Comfort Topping Recipe
Step 1: Sauté the Aromatics and Mushrooms
Begin by melting the butter along with olive oil in a large skillet over medium heat. Once shimmering, add the finely chopped onions and sauté until translucent and soft, about 3-4 minutes. Stir in the minced garlic and cook for another minute until fragrant. Then, add the sliced mushrooms. Cook, stirring occasionally, until they shrink, turn golden, and release their delicious earthy aroma – this usually takes about 8 minutes. This step builds the flavor foundation for the gravy with caramelized sweetness and mushroom depth.
Step 2: Create the Roux
Sprinkle the all-purpose flour over the mushroom mixture, stirring constantly for 1-2 minutes. This step is key to cook out the raw flour taste and start forming the gravy’s thick, velvety texture. The flour coats the mushrooms and onions, which will help the liquid bind perfectly later on.
Step 3: Add the Liquid Ingredients
Gradually pour in the vegetable or chicken broth, stirring as you go to prevent lumps from forming. Let the mixture simmer gently to thicken for about 5 minutes, stirring occasionally to scrape any browned bits from the pan bottom – these bits add wonderful flavor. Then, stir in the heavy cream and soy sauce if using. Continue to cook for another 2-3 minutes until the gravy is smooth, thickened, and creamy.
Step 4: Season and Finish
Season the gravy generously with salt and pepper to taste. If you opted for fresh herbs, fold the thyme or parsley into the warm gravy now for an inviting burst of color and aroma. Remove from heat and get ready to drizzle over your favorite dishes.
How to Serve Creamy Mushroom Gravy: The Ultimate Comfort Topping Recipe

Garnishes
A sprinkle of fresh chopped parsley or thyme not only brightens the look of this creamy mushroom gravy but also lifts its earthy flavors perfectly. You could also add a dash of cracked black pepper or a swirl of cream on top just before serving to make it extra inviting.
Side Dishes
This gravy pairs beautifully with classic comfort foods like mashed potatoes, roasted or steamed vegetables, biscuits, and biscuits. It’s also glorious over roasted chicken, beef, or even a hearty vegan lentil loaf. The versatility of this sauce means it enhances everything from your simplest meals to more special occasions.
Creative Ways to Present
For a fun twist, try spooning this creamy mushroom gravy over toasted bread or savory waffles for a cozy brunch option. Drizzle it on baked sweet potatoes or use it as a sauce for pasta or grain bowls. Getting creative with how you serve the gravy can turn everyday meals into memorable indulgences.
Make Ahead and Storage
Storing Leftovers
Leftover creamy mushroom gravy keeps beautifully in an airtight container in the refrigerator for up to 4 days. This makes it easy to prepare ahead and enjoy on busy nights or as a quick upgrade to leftovers.
Freezing
You can freeze this gravy for up to 2 months. For best results, let it cool completely before transferring to a freezer-safe container. When thawing, do so overnight in the refrigerator to maintain its creamy texture and flavor.
Reheating
Reheat the gravy gently on the stovetop over low heat, stirring frequently. Adding a splash of broth or cream can help restore any thickness lost during storage. Avoid high heat to prevent curdling and keep it silky smooth.
FAQs
Can I use other types of mushrooms?
Absolutely! While cremini or button mushrooms are recommended for their texture and flavor, you can use shiitake, portobello, or even wild mushrooms for different flavor profiles. Just adjust cooking time if needed since some mushrooms release more moisture.
Is there a dairy-free version of this gravy?
Yes, you can substitute the butter for a plant-based margarine and use coconut cream or cashew cream instead of heavy cream. Just be mindful that coconut cream adds a subtle sweetness that might slightly change the flavor.
Can I make this gravy gluten-free?
Yes, simply replace the all-purpose flour with a gluten-free flour blend or cornstarch slurry. If using cornstarch, mix it with cold broth before adding to avoid lumps.
Why add soy sauce to the gravy?
Soy sauce contributes a deeper umami and saltiness that enhances the mushroom flavor beautifully, making the gravy taste more robust and layered. It’s optional but highly recommended for flavor depth.
How thick should the gravy be?
The perfect creamy mushroom gravy should be pourable but thick enough to coat the back of a spoon. If it’s too runny, let it simmer a little longer; if too thick, thin with a splash of broth or cream until you reach your preferred consistency.
Final Thoughts
I can’t recommend enough giving this Creamy Mushroom Gravy: The Ultimate Comfort Topping Recipe a try the next time you want to elevate your meal with something that feels both indulgent and nourishing. It’s one of those recipes that bring people together around the table, making regular dinners feel like special occasions. Once you master this gravy, you’ll wonder how you ever lived without it!
Print
Creamy Mushroom Gravy: The Ultimate Comfort Topping Recipe
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Total Time: 25 minutes
- Yield: 4 servings
- Category: Sauce
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
This Creamy Mushroom Gravy is a rich and savory sauce made with sautéed mushrooms, onions, and garlic, blended with a creamy base for the ultimate comfort topping. Ideal for drizzling over mashed potatoes, roasted meats, or steamed vegetables, it brings a delicious, gourmet flair to your dishes in just 25 minutes.
Ingredients
Base Ingredients
- 2 tablespoons butter
- 1 tablespoon olive oil
- 8 oz mushrooms (such as cremini or button), sliced
- 1 small onion, finely chopped
- 2 cloves garlic, minced
Thickening and Liquid Components
- 2 tablespoons all-purpose flour
- 1 1/2 cups vegetable broth (or chicken broth for non-vegetarians)
- 1/2 cup heavy cream (or milk for a lighter option)
Flavor Enhancers and Seasoning
- 1 teaspoon soy sauce (optional, for depth of flavor)
- Salt and pepper to taste
- Optional: 1 tablespoon fresh thyme or parsley, chopped
Instructions
- Heat Fat and Sauté Vegetables: In a medium skillet, melt the butter with olive oil over medium heat. Add the sliced mushrooms, chopped onion, and minced garlic. Cook, stirring occasionally, until the mushrooms are browned and the onions are translucent, about 5-7 minutes.
- Add Flour to Thicken: Sprinkle the all-purpose flour over the sautéed vegetables and stir well to coat. Cook the mixture for 1-2 minutes to remove the raw flour taste, stirring constantly.
- Add Broth and Simmer: Slowly pour in the vegetable or chicken broth while stirring continuously to prevent lumps. Bring the mixture to a gentle boil, then reduce heat and let it simmer for 5-7 minutes until thickened.
- Incorporate Cream and Seasoning: Stir in the heavy cream (or milk) and soy sauce if using. Season with salt and pepper to taste. Continue cooking for an additional 3-5 minutes, allowing the flavors to meld and the gravy to reach a creamy consistency.
- Finish with Herbs and Serve: Remove from heat and stir in fresh thyme or parsley if desired. Serve the creamy mushroom gravy warm over mashed potatoes, meats, or vegetables for a comforting, flavorful addition.
Notes
- For a lighter version, substitute heavy cream with milk or a non-dairy alternative like almond milk.
- Use gluten-free flour to make this gravy gluten-free.
- Add a splash of white wine when adding broth for extra depth.
- Store leftover gravy in an airtight container in the fridge for up to 3 days.
- Reheat gently on the stovetop, adding a bit of broth or milk if thickened too much.

